Long story but my father has a aluminium roofrack sitting at his place which was for his now long gone range rover. It was i think a 89 model it had a viscous centre diff would that be about right?? Anyway the roofrack is mine if I want it.
I have a series 2 disco, I spoke to the manufacturer of the roof rack and he said that that age range rover, and the series 1 and 2 disco's all have the same width roof and use the same roof rack.
I thought the rangerover was wider than the disco's.
Any experts out there
Aaron
I'm not too sure about the width, but the Disco roof is stepped. The rear section is a lot higher above the gutter than the Range Rover.
I very much doubt that it will fit without a lot of work to the mounts.
Scott
Wont fit, i have a full length rack off my rangie and there is no way it will fit my D1 without making new legs to account for the step in the rear.
